Goats are being seen in a livestock market on the eve of the Muslim festival of Eid-al-Adha in Mumbai, India, on June 15, 2024. Muslims worldwide are celebrating Eid al-Adha, or Feast of Sacrifice, that is commemorating the willingness of the Prophet Ibrahim to sacrifice his son. During the holiday, Muslims are slaughtering livestock, distributing part of the meat to the poor.
